The concept

The parking brake is used to prevent the vehicle from rolling when it is parked.

  • Engine switched off: the parking brake acts on the rear wheels.
  • Engine running: the parking brake acts on the disc brakes of the front and rear wheels via the hydraulic brake system.

The parking brake can be set manually or automatically:

  • Manual: by pulling and pushing the switch.
  • Automatic: by activating Automatic Hold.
